GlassIt Linux

GlassIt VSC is a popular Windows-only transparency extension for VSCode. GlassIt Linux expands that functionality to include standard Linux window managers such as GNOME.

Prerequisites

GlassIt Linux requires wmctrl (to get the window ID), xprop (to set transparency), and bash (to run the transparency commands) installed on your system. These come standard with most Linux distributions, but just in case, you can install them with:

sudo apt install -y wmctrl x11-utils bash

Usage

  • Install the extension
  • Restart any single VSCode window

Settings

Opacity defaults to 97%, but can be set with the setting Glassit-linux: Opacity in VSCode's settings window. A restart of any single window is required for this setting to take effect.
